    The engine is a JAP model S80 which was fitted to the Gardenmaster 80. Attached are parts list for engine and manual for the Gardenmaster 80

    The Museum of English Rural Life (MERL) at Reading, have the serial number records for Allen Scythes and may be able to help.

    Looking in Brian Bell’s book 70 Years of Garden Machinery it says “accessories for the M&G push hoes made by Murwood Agricultural at Grosvenor Gardens London and Aldridge in Staffordshire”

    It might be worth enquiring if the original authority that issued the registration mark retained the original records in their archive, not all did. FO appears to be Radnorshire which I think is now part of Powys.

    If the number was spare ie vehicle declared scrap, then the number may have been reissued as an age related plate. It may be worth contacting the DVLA to find out.
